Former Schroders head of derivatives Darren Cannon has joined Martin Currie as chief operating officer, reporting to chief executive Willie Watt (pictured).
Prior to Schroders, Cannon worked at UBS Global Asset Management as head of global operations and head of Asia Pacific operations. He first joined the firm in 1989. Cannon will have overall responsibility for Martin Currie's operational functions, including information technology, client reporting, investment operations, transitions and the project team. He will also serve as a member of the executive committee.
